The cheapest way to get from Norwalk to Exton is to drive which costs $28 - $45 and takes 3h 7m.
The fastest way to get from Norwalk to Exton is to drive which takes 3h 7m and costs $28 - $45.
No, there is no direct train from Norwalk to Exton. However, there are services departing from East Norwalk and arriving at Exton Amtrak via Stamford Amtrak Station and Ny Moynihan Train Hall At Penn Station.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 53m.
The distance between Norwalk and Exton is 163 miles. The road distance is 155.2 miles.
The best way to get from Norwalk to Exton without a car is to train which takes 4h 53m and costs $45 - $650.
It takes approximately 4h 53m to get from Norwalk to Exton, including transfers.
Norwalk to Exton train services, operated by Amtrak, depart from Stamford Amtrak Station.
Norwalk to Exton train services, operated by Amtrak, arrive at Ny Moynihan Train Hall At Penn Station.
Yes, the driving distance between Norwalk to Exton is 155 miles. It takes approximately 3h 7m to drive from Norwalk to Exton.
